摘要
The densities at T = (288.15, 293.15, 298.15, 303.15, and 308.15) K and sound velocities at T = 298.15 K have been measured for aqueous solutions of urea, N-methylurea, N,N'-dimethylurea, N,N,N'N'-tetramethylurea, N-ethylurea, N,N'-diethylurea, N-butylurea. From these data the apparent molar volumes, V-Phi the apparent molar isentropic compressions, K-S,K-Phi, and the Passynski solvation numbers of solutes have been determined. The concentration dependencies of the calculated quantities and their limiting values are discussed in terms of solute-solvent and solute-solute interactions. (C) 2012 Elsevier Ltd.
